Cervical cancer vaccine, Cervarix, slowed by FDA

The Food an Drug Administration is not going to grant a priority review to its experimental cancer vaccine Cervarix. Adding pressure GlaxoSmithKline’s controversy surrounding its diabetes drug Avandia.

Cervarix will now have to go through a standard 10 month review, instead of going the fast track route. The company is defending its diabetes drug after a study published in the New England Journal of Medicine said that those taking the drug are at greater risks of heart attacks.

GlaxoSmithKline expects to market the drug Cervarix in the United States sometime in 2008.
